Developing an Ergonomic Risk Assessment Tool and Work Rotation Plan

The overall objective of this project is to reduce ergonomic risk and the potential for workplace injury across the entire production facility. Repetition, force and posture are factors that can lead to fatigue and injury among workers in a manufacturing setting. By developing an ergonomic demands and risk assessment tool based on current research, the risk associated with each workstation in the facility will be quantified, and recommendations to reduce or eliminate risk of potential injury will be provided. Job rotation schedules will also be proposed that utilize the data from the ergonomic assessments to vary the type of physical demands that worker are exposed to in different areas within the facility. This will reduce the chance of workplace injuries and hopefully increase worker satisfaction.
